There are several natural ingredients used in pet-friendly weedkillers, which can be used to kill annual weeds and the top growth of perennial ones. Although these are ‘natural’ products, keep pets off treated areas until the spray has dried. Acetic acid is the active ingredient of vinegar and is available as ready-to-use weedkiller spray ...Create an organic herbicide by mixing 1 cup of salt with 1 gallon of white vinegar. Add a teaspoon of liquid soap and place in a spray bottle. Use just as you would a chemical herbicide. Heat plants with hot air from a heat gun, such as the type used for stripping paint. Hold the gun 2 to 3 inches above the weeds and grass and wait until the centers wilt before removing it. Best organic options for gravel driveways: Here are some organic herbicides you can use on your gravel driveway: Horticultural Vinegar: This is a very strong vinegar solution (20-30% acetic acid) that can kill weeds quickly. However, it is essential to apply it correctly since it is potent and can burn the skin.Mar 17, 2024 · For driveways, therefore, herbicides with a high residual activity/persistence are recommended. However, be careful if you have a gravel driveway, as herbicides with a high persistence can easily get washed into areas of desired plants when it rains.

Sterilant Weed Control for Gravel and Driveways. Our sterilant program consists of two treatments annually to prevent the germination of new weeds and grasses. The first application is made in the spring as the new growth is starting. We utilize a combination of pre and post emergent herbicides to kill the existing vegetation and to provide a ...Steps. Fill a container with 1 gallon of white vinegar. Add one tablespoon of dish soap to the vinegar. Optional: Pour in 1 cup of salt. Mix the solution thoroughly until ingredients are well combined.
